Google se compromete a impulsar la igualdad racial para las comunidades afrodescendientes. Obtén información al respecto.
Se usó la API de Cloud Translation para traducir esta página.
Switch to English

TestDeviceOptions

public class TestDeviceOptions
extends Object

java.lang.Object
com.android.tradefed.device.TestDeviceOptions


Contenedor para ITestDevice Option s

Resumen

Clases anidadas

enum TestDeviceOptions.InstanceType

Constantes

int DEFAULT_ADB_PORT

Campos

public static final String INSTANCE_TYPE_OPTION

Constructores públicos

TestDeviceOptions ()

Métodos públicos

int getAdbRecoveryTimeout ()
long getAvailableTimeout ()
File getAvdConfigFile ()

Devuelva el archivo de configuración de Gce Avd para iniciar la instancia.

String getAvdConfigTestResourceName ()

Devuelve el nombre del recurso de prueba de configuración de Gce Avd para iniciar la instancia.

File getAvdDriverBinary ()

Devuelva la ruta al binario para iniciar la instancia de Gce Avd.

String getBaseImage ()

Devuelve el nombre de la imagen base que se utilizará para la instancia actual

String getConnCheckUrl ()
static String getCreateCommandByInstanceType ( TestDeviceOptions.InstanceType type)
Integer getCutoffBattery ()
static getExtraParamsByInstanceType ( TestDeviceOptions.InstanceType type, String baseImage)
int getFastbootTimeout ()
String getGceAccount ()

Devuelva la cuenta de correo electrónico de gce para usar con el controlador

long getGceCmdTimeout ()

Devuelve el tiempo de espera de Gce Avd para que la instancia se conecte.

String getGceDriverBuildIdParam ()

Devuelve el parámetro del controlador GCE que debe emparejarse con el ID de compilación de la información de compilación

Log.LogLevel getGceDriverLogLevel ()

Devuelve el nivel de registro del controlador Gce Avd.

getGceDriverParams ()

Devuelve los parámetros adicionales del controlador GCE proporcionados a través de la opción

int getGceMaxAttempt ()

Devuelve el número máximo de intentos para iniciar un dispositivo gce

TestDeviceOptions.InstanceType getInstanceType ()

Devuelve el tipo de instancia de dispositivo virtual que se debe crear.

String getInstanceUser ()

Devuelve el tipo de instancia del dispositivo virtual GCE que se debe crear.

String getLogcatOptions ()
long getMaxLogcatDataSize ()

Obtenga el tamaño máximo aproximado de los datos de tmp logcat para retener, en bytes.

long getMaxWifiConnectTime ()
long getOnlineTimeout ()
getPostBootCommands ()
int getRebootTimeout ()
int getRemoteAdbPort ()

Devuelve el puerto remoto en la instancia que escucha el servidor adb

getRemoteFetchFilePattern ()

Devuelve la lista de patrones que se intentarán recuperar mediante scp.

File getSerivceAccountJsonKeyFile ()
File getSshPrivateKeyPath ()

Devuelve la ruta de la clave ssh para usarla en operaciones con la instancia de Gce Avd.

int getUnencryptRebootTimeout ()
boolean getUseFastbootErase ()
int getWifiAttempts ()
int getWifiRetryWaitTime ()
String getWifiUtilAPKPath ()
boolean isDisableKeyguard ()

Compruebe si deberíamos intentar deshabilitar el bloqueo de teclas una vez que se haya completado el arranque

boolean isEnableAdbRoot ()

Compruebe si la raíz de adb debe estar habilitada al arrancar para este dispositivo

boolean isLogcatCaptureEnabled ()
boolean isWifiExpoRetryEnabled ()
void setAdbRecoveryTimeout (int adbRecoveryTimeout)
void setAvdConfigFile (File avdConfigFile)

Configure el archivo de configuración de Gce Avd para iniciar la instancia.

void setAvdDriverBinary (File avdDriverBinary)

Establezca la ruta al binario para iniciar la instancia de Gce Avd.

void setConnCheckUrl (String url)
void setCutoffBattery (int cutoffBattery)

establezca el nivel mínimo de batería para continuar con la invocación.

void setDisableKeyguard (boolean disableKeyguard)

Establecer si debemos intentar deshabilitar el bloqueo de teclas una vez que se haya completado el arranque

void setFastbootTimeout (int fastbootTimeout)
void setGceCmdTimeout (long gceCmdTimeout)

Establezca el tiempo de espera de Gce Avd para que la instancia se conecte.

void setGceDriverBuildIdParam (String gceDriverBuildIdParam)

Establezca el parámetro del controlador GCE que debe emparejarse con el ID de compilación de la información de compilación

void setGceDriverLogLevel (Log.LogLevel mGceDriverLogLevel)

Configure el nivel de registro del controlador Gce Avd.

void setGceMaxAttempt (int gceMaxAttempt)

Establecer el número máximo de intentos para iniciar un dispositivo gce

void setLogcatOptions (String logcatOptions)

Establecer las opciones que se transmitirán a logcat

void setMaxLogcatDataSize (long maxLogcatDataSize)

Establecer el tamaño máximo aproximado de un tmp logcat para retener, en bytes

void setOnlineTimeout (long onlineTimeout)
void setRebootTimeout (int rebootTimeout)
void setServiceAccountJsonKeyFile (File jsonKeyFile)

Configure el archivo de clave json de la cuenta de servicio.

void setSshPrivateKeyPath (File sshPrivateKeyPath)

Establezca la ruta de la clave ssh que se utilizará para las operaciones con la instancia de Gce Avd.

void setUnencryptRebootTimeout (int unencryptRebootTimeout)
void setUseFastbootErase (boolean useFastbootErase)
void setWifiAttempts (int wifiAttempts)
boolean shouldDisableReboot ()
boolean shouldSkipTearDown ()

Devuelve verdadero si se debe omitir el desmontaje de GCE.

boolean shouldUseContentProvider ()

Devuelve si el proveedor de contenido Tradefed se puede utilizar para enviar / extraer archivos.

boolean waitForGceTearDown ()

Devuelve verdadero si debemos bloquear la finalización del desmontaje de GCE antes de continuar.

Constantes

DEFAULT_ADB_PORT

public static final int DEFAULT_ADB_PORT

Valor constante: 5555 (0x000015b3)

Campos

INSTANCE_TYPE_OPTION

public static final String INSTANCE_TYPE_OPTION

Constructores públicos

TestDeviceOptions

public TestDeviceOptions ()

Métodos públicos

getAdbRecoveryTimeout

public int getAdbRecoveryTimeout ()

Devoluciones
int el tiempo de espera en ms para arrancar en modo de recuperación.

getAvailableTimeout

public long getAvailableTimeout ()

Devoluciones
long el tiempo predeterminado en ms para esperar a que un dispositivo esté disponible.

getAvdConfigFile

public File getAvdConfigFile ()

Devuelva el archivo de configuración de Gce Avd para iniciar la instancia.

Devoluciones
File

getAvdConfigTestResourceName

public String getAvdConfigTestResourceName ()

Devuelve el nombre del recurso de prueba de configuración de Gce Avd para iniciar la instancia.

Devoluciones
String

getAvdDriverBinary

public File getAvdDriverBinary ()

Devuelva la ruta al binario para iniciar la instancia de Gce Avd.

Devoluciones
File

getBaseImage

public String getBaseImage ()

Devuelve el nombre de la imagen base que se utilizará para la instancia actual.

Devoluciones
String

getConnCheckUrl

public String getConnCheckUrl ()

Devoluciones
String la URL predeterminada que se utilizará para las pruebas de conectividad.

getCreateCommandByInstanceType

public static String getCreateCommandByInstanceType (TestDeviceOptions.InstanceType type)

Parámetros
type TestDeviceOptions.InstanceType

Devoluciones
String

getCutoffBattery

public Integer getCutoffBattery ()

Devoluciones
Integer el nivel mínimo de batería para continuar con la invocación.

getExtraParamsByInstanceType

public static  getExtraParamsByInstanceType (TestDeviceOptions.InstanceType type, 
                String baseImage)

Parámetros
type TestDeviceOptions.InstanceType

baseImage String

Devoluciones

getFastbootTimeout

public int getFastbootTimeout ()

Devoluciones
int el tiempo de espera para arrancar en modo fastboot en ms.

getGceAccount

public String getGceAccount ()

Devuelva la cuenta de correo electrónico de gce para usar con el controlador

Devoluciones
String

getGceCmdTimeout

public long getGceCmdTimeout ()

Devuelve el tiempo de espera de Gce Avd para que la instancia se conecte.

Devoluciones
long

getGceDriverBuildIdParam

public String getGceDriverBuildIdParam ()

Devuelve el parámetro del controlador GCE que debe emparejarse con el ID de compilación de la información de compilación

Devoluciones
String

getGceDriverLogLevel

public Log.LogLevel getGceDriverLogLevel ()

Devuelve el nivel de registro del controlador Gce Avd.

Devoluciones
Log.LogLevel

getGceDriverParams

public  getGceDriverParams ()

Devuelve los parámetros adicionales del controlador GCE proporcionados a través de la opción

Devoluciones

getGceMaxAttempt

public int getGceMaxAttempt ()

Devuelve el número máximo de intentos para iniciar un dispositivo gce

Devoluciones
int

getInstanceType

public TestDeviceOptions.InstanceType getInstanceType ()

Devuelve el tipo de instancia de dispositivo virtual que se debe crear.

Devoluciones
TestDeviceOptions.InstanceType

getInstanceUser

public String getInstanceUser ()

Devuelve el tipo de instancia del dispositivo virtual GCE que se debe crear.

Devoluciones
String

getLogcatOptions

public String getLogcatOptions ()

Devoluciones
String las opciones de logcat configuradas

getMaxLogcatDataSize

public long getMaxLogcatDataSize ()

Obtenga el tamaño máximo aproximado de los datos de tmp logcat para retener, en bytes.

Devoluciones
long

getMaxWifiConnectTime

public long getMaxWifiConnectTime ()

Devoluciones
long el tiempo máximo para intentar conectarse a wifi.

getOnlineTimeout

public long getOnlineTimeout ()

Devoluciones
long el tiempo predeterminado en ms para esperar a que un dispositivo esté en línea.

getPostBootCommands

public  getPostBootCommands ()

Devoluciones
una lista de comandos de shell para ejecutar después de reiniciar.

getRebootTimeout

public int getRebootTimeout ()

Devoluciones
int el tiempo de espera en ms para el arranque completo del sistema.

getRemoteAdbPort

public int getRemoteAdbPort ()

Devuelve el puerto remoto en la instancia que escucha el servidor adb

Devoluciones
int

getRemoteFetchFilePattern

public  getRemoteFetchFilePattern ()

Devuelve la lista de patrones que se intentarán recuperar mediante scp.

Devoluciones

getSerivceAccountJsonKeyFile

public File getSerivceAccountJsonKeyFile ()

Devoluciones
File el archivo de clave json de la cuenta de servicio.

getSshPrivateKeyPath

public File getSshPrivateKeyPath ()

Devuelve la ruta de la clave ssh para usarla en las operaciones con la instancia de Gce Avd.

Devoluciones
File

getUnencryptRebootTimeout

public int getUnencryptRebootTimeout ()

Devoluciones
int el tiempo de espera en ms para que se formatee el sistema de archivos y que el dispositivo se reinicie después de la desencriptación.

getUseFastbootErase

public boolean getUseFastbootErase ()

Devoluciones
boolean si usar fastboot erase en lugar del formato fastboot para borrar particiones.

getWifiAttempts

public int getWifiAttempts ()

Devoluciones
int el número predeterminado de intentos para conectarse a la red wifi.

getWifiRetryWaitTime

public int getWifiRetryWaitTime ()

Devoluciones
int el tiempo de espera base entre reintentos de conexión wifi.

getWifiUtilAPKPath

public String getWifiUtilAPKPath ()

Devoluciones
String la ruta de wifiutil apk

isDisableKeyguard

public boolean isDisableKeyguard ()

Compruebe si deberíamos intentar deshabilitar el bloqueo de teclas una vez que se haya completado el arranque

Devoluciones
boolean

isEnableAdbRoot

public boolean isEnableAdbRoot ()

Compruebe si la raíz de adb debe estar habilitada al arrancar para este dispositivo

Devoluciones
boolean

isLogcatCaptureEnabled

public boolean isLogcatCaptureEnabled ()

Devoluciones
boolean Verdadero si la captura de logcat en segundo plano está habilitada

isWifiExpoRetryEnabled

public boolean isWifiExpoRetryEnabled ()

Devoluciones
boolean si se debe utilizar la estrategia de reintento exponencial.

setAdbRecoveryTimeout

public void setAdbRecoveryTimeout (int adbRecoveryTimeout)

Parámetros
adbRecoveryTimeout int : el tiempo de espera en ms para arrancar en modo de recuperación.

setAvdConfigFile

public void setAvdConfigFile (File avdConfigFile)

Configure el archivo de configuración de Gce Avd para iniciar la instancia.

Parámetros
avdConfigFile File

setAvdDriverBinary

public void setAvdDriverBinary (File avdDriverBinary)

Establezca la ruta al binario para iniciar la instancia de Gce Avd.

Parámetros
avdDriverBinary File

setConnCheckUrl

public void setConnCheckUrl (String url)

Parámetros
url String

setCutoffBattery

public void setCutoffBattery (int cutoffBattery)

establezca el nivel mínimo de batería para continuar con la invocación.

Parámetros
cutoffBattery int

setDisableKeyguard

public void setDisableKeyguard (boolean disableKeyguard)

Establecer si debemos intentar deshabilitar el bloqueo de teclas una vez que se haya completado el arranque

Parámetros
disableKeyguard boolean

setFastbootTimeout

public void setFastbootTimeout (int fastbootTimeout)

Parámetros
fastbootTimeout int : el tiempo de espera en msecs para arrancar en modo fastboot.

setGceCmdTimeout

public void setGceCmdTimeout (long gceCmdTimeout)

Establezca el tiempo de espera de Gce Avd para que la instancia se conecte.

Parámetros
gceCmdTimeout long

setGceDriverBuildIdParam

public void setGceDriverBuildIdParam (String gceDriverBuildIdParam)

Establezca el parámetro del controlador GCE que debe emparejarse con el ID de compilación de la información de compilación

Parámetros
gceDriverBuildIdParam String

setGceDriverLogLevel

public void setGceDriverLogLevel (Log.LogLevel mGceDriverLogLevel)

Configure el nivel de registro del controlador Gce Avd.

Parámetros
mGceDriverLogLevel Log.LogLevel

setGceMaxAttempt

public void setGceMaxAttempt (int gceMaxAttempt)

Establecer el número máximo de intentos para iniciar un dispositivo gce

Parámetros
gceMaxAttempt int

setLogcatOptions

public void setLogcatOptions (String logcatOptions)

Establecer las opciones que se transmitirán a logcat

Parámetros
logcatOptions String

setMaxLogcatDataSize

public void setMaxLogcatDataSize (long maxLogcatDataSize)

Establecer el tamaño máximo aproximado de un tmp logcat para retener, en bytes

Parámetros
maxLogcatDataSize long

setOnlineTimeout

public void setOnlineTimeout (long onlineTimeout)

Parámetros
onlineTimeout long

setRebootTimeout

public void setRebootTimeout (int rebootTimeout)

Parámetros
rebootTimeout int : el tiempo de espera en ms para que el sistema se inicie por completo.

setServiceAccountJsonKeyFile

public void setServiceAccountJsonKeyFile (File jsonKeyFile)

Configure el archivo de clave json de la cuenta de servicio.

Parámetros
jsonKeyFile File : el archivo de claves.

setSshPrivateKeyPath

public void setSshPrivateKeyPath (File sshPrivateKeyPath)

Establezca la ruta de la clave ssh que se utilizará para las operaciones con la instancia de Gce Avd.

Parámetros
sshPrivateKeyPath File

setUnencryptRebootTimeout

public void setUnencryptRebootTimeout (int unencryptRebootTimeout)

Parámetros
unencryptRebootTimeout int : el tiempo de espera en ms para que se formatee el sistema de archivos y que el dispositivo se reinicie después de la desencriptación.

setUseFastbootErase

public void setUseFastbootErase (boolean useFastbootErase)

Parámetros
useFastbootErase boolean : si se debe usar fastboot erase en lugar del formato fastboot para borrar particiones.

setWifiAttempts

public void setWifiAttempts (int wifiAttempts)

Parámetros
wifiAttempts int

shouldDisableReboot

public boolean shouldDisableReboot ()

Devoluciones
boolean si el reinicio del dispositivo debe estar deshabilitado

shouldSkipTearDown

public boolean shouldSkipTearDown ()

Devuelve verdadero si se debe omitir el desmontaje de GCE. Falso de lo contrario.

Devoluciones
boolean

shouldUseContentProvider

public boolean shouldUseContentProvider ()

Devuelve si el proveedor de contenido Tradefed se puede utilizar para enviar / extraer archivos.

Devoluciones
boolean

waitForGceTearDown

public boolean waitForGceTearDown ()

Devuelve verdadero si debemos bloquear la finalización del desmontaje de GCE antes de continuar.

Devoluciones
boolean